Halloween night I spotted this 2016 McLaren 650S traveling east on Detroit.

As the car sits, in a 2021 market it is worth about $280,000.00!

Image
Engine: 3.8 l V8
Power: 641 hp @ 7,250 rpm (478 kW)
Torque: 500 lb·ft @ 6,000 rpm (678 N·m)
Induction: Turbocharged

Image
Now here is where the world just got smaller. Zak Brown the current CEO of McLaren worldwide based in England, spent a couple summers in Lakewood, Ohio in his early racing years. Today he is considered one of the most powerful people in motor racing, besides heading up McLaren LTD, he also has one of the most extensive collections of historically significant cars and race cars in the world.

Just one of Lakewood's little inputs into Formula One and International Motorsports. There are many more!

We have a new winner meet the 2022 Rolls-Royce Cullinan base starting price $351,250 to over $700,000

Image
This one sitting in front of Dave's Hot Chicken was $547,000

Image
From "Car and Driver" magazine, "The Cullinan's twin-turbo 6.7-liter V-12 provides 563 horsepower (592 in the Black Badge model) and is whisper quiet, lest it disturb the VIPs in the cabin. The one we tested recorded a 60-mph time of just 4.5 seconds—impressive for a vehicle that weighs about three tons."
